1. The Aviation Law of Partial Pressures: Why the Altitude Squeeze Happens

To defeat the problem of an exploding or leaking vape on a commercial airliner, you must first understand the environmental forces at play from a hardware engineering perspective.

When you are standing on the ground at sea level in Sydney or Melbourne, the atmospheric pressure pushing against the outside of your vape device is perfectly equalized with the internal pressure inside the e-liquid reservoir. The surface tension of the fluid, combined with the dense fibers of the organic cotton wick, forms a stable vacuum seal that holds the e-liquid securely inside the pod.

However, when a commercial passenger airplane ascends to its cruising altitude of 35,000 feet, the external atmosphere becomes incredibly thin. To keep passengers safe and comfortable, the aircraft cabin is artificially pressurized. But a crucial detail to recognize is that the cabin is not pressurized to match sea-level conditions; instead, it simulates an ambient altitude of roughly 6,000 to 8,000 feet above sea level.

This means that as the airplane climbs, the air pressure inside the cabin drops significantly. Because your vape device was sealed on the ground, the tiny pocket of ambient air trapped at the top of your e-liquid reservoir remains locked at its original, high, sea-level pressure.

According to Boyle's Law in basic physics, as external pressure decreases, a trapped gas must expand in volume. That expanding pocket of sea-level air has only one goal: to escape the rigid boundaries of the vape tank. As it expands, it acts exactly like a pneumatic syringe plunger, violently forcing the heavy e-liquid down through the wicking cotton, flooding the atomization chamber, and leaking out through the mouthpiece and bottom airflow vents.

 

2. The Damage Assessment: How Leaked E-Liquid Affects Internal Circuits

A cabin pressure leak is not merely a messy inconvenience; it introduces severe mechanical and electrical risks to the underlying hardware circuitry of your device.

Modern disposable electronic cigarettes are highly sophisticated pieces of micro-engineering. They feature integrated airflow sensors, lithium-ion battery cells, printed circuit boards (PCBs), and vibrant LED digital smart screens. When an altitude squeeze forces e-liquid out of the tank reservoir, the fluid doesn't just leak out into your bag; it often flows downward into the internal battery compartment.

E-liquid is composed of Propylene Glycol and Vegetable Glycerin, both of which are highly viscous and naturally conduct moisture over time. When this fluid covers the internal PCB or wraps around the delicate contacts of the automatic airflow sensor, it triggers several critical hardware failures:

  • Automatic Auto-Firing: The thick liquid can gum up the flexible membrane of the airflow sensor, causing the device to continuously fire on its own inside your carry-on luggage. This rapidly overheats the coil, burns the wick, and can push the lithium battery into an unsafe state.

  • The Corrosive Short-Circuit: The chemical compounds in the liquid can slowly corrode the delicate copper solder joints on the circuit board, leading to complete electrical failure, meaning your device will refuse to turn on or accept a charge when you land.

 

3. The Inversion Method: Manipulating Gravity to Protect Your Vape

Now, let us dive into the practical, hands-on methodology. To completely defeat the laws of aviation physics, you do not need expensive tools; you simply need to manipulate gravity to your advantage using the Inversion Method.

The reason a vape leaks during a climb is that the e-liquid sits at the bottom of the device due to gravity, completely covering the wicking holes and the central airflow chimney. When the air pocket at the top expands, it has no choice but to push through the liquid to find an escape route.

[Upright Position on Plane]   ──► Air pocket expands ──► Pushes liquid OUT through wicking holes (LEAK)
[Inverted Position on Plane]  ──► Air pocket slides to vents ──► Air vents out cleanly (BONE-DRY)

To counteract this, you must turn your disposable vape completely upside down the moment you board the aircraft and settle into your seat. In this inverted position, the gravity-fed e-liquid slides down toward the mouthpiece end of the reservoir, completely away from the bottom airflow inlets and wicking ports.

Now, the trapped air pocket sits directly adjacent to the escape vents. As the aircraft climbs and the cabin pressure drops, the expanding air can vent out of the device smoothly and cleanly as a gas, without dragging a single drop of sticky e-liquid along with it. Your device stays bone-dry, and your flavor profile remains perfectly intact.

4. The Quarantine Protocol: Essential Travel Packing Tools for Your Carry-On

While the Inversion Method is your primary defense against altitude changes, a smart traveler should always establish a secondary containment barrier using a proper Quarantine Protocol. When packing your carry-on backpack before heading to the airport terminal, add these three inexpensive, everyday items to your routine:

  • Heavy-Duty Dual-Lock Zip-Lock Bags: Do not use cheap, single-seal sandwich bags. You need thick, freezer-grade plastic bags featuring a robust dual-zip locking mechanism. This acts as your absolute barrier; if an extreme pressure shift causes a leak, the sticky fluid stays securely isolated within the plastic, protecting your passport and electronics.

  • Absorbent Unscented Paper Towels: Wrap each individual vape device neatly in a clean layer of paper towel before placing it inside the bag. This layer immediately catches any trace droplets of condensation or minor leaks before they can build up.

  • Silicon Dust Plugs and Stickers: If your disposable vape arrived with a tiny silicon rubber plug inserted into the top mouthpiece and a safety sticker covering the bottom airflow hole, do not throw them away. Save them in your luggage and re-insert them tightly before your flight to provide a strong physical barrier against pressure drops.

7. Frequently Asked Questions (FAQ)

Can you take high-puff disposable vapes through TSA inside carry-on luggage?

Yes, you can legally bring disposable vapes through airport security checkpoints inside your carry-on luggage or personal items. Aviation safety regulations strictly dictate that all electronic cigarettes and lithium batteries must remain in the passenger cabin and are completely prohibited inside checked, hold baggage due to potential fire hazards.

Why do vapes leak so aggressively during an airplane flight?

Vapes leak during a flight because of changes in airplane cabin pressure. As the aircraft ascends, the ambient air pressure inside the cabin drops, causing the pocket of sea-level air trapped inside your vape's e-liquid tank to rapidly expand. This expanding air acts like a syringe, forcing the e-liquid out through the wicking ports and mouthpiece.

How does the Inversion Method stop a vape from leaking on a plane?

The Inversion Method requires you to store your vape completely upside down (mouthpiece pointing down) during the flight. This uses gravity to slide the e-liquid away from the wicking ports, positioning the trapped air bubble directly next to the airflow escape vents so it can expand and vent out cleanly as a gas without dragging liquid along with it.
